Linda de Canha
(She/Her)
Linda is Portuguese, South African and has called the UK home for over 20 years. She believes these diverse cultures has shaped how she sees the world and continues to inspire her work.
Her art and illustration practice is driven by her passion for drawing and follows her fascination for storytelling. She is deeply curious and so you will often find her researching various subjects and experimenting with different materials.
She loves to explore different themes and seeks out opportunities on ways visual storytelling can inspire readers to open their mind with their eyes.
At heart she is obsessed on what it means to be human - even if it means drawing a bird to convey this.

Bumbalina - The Bumbling Bee
Bumbalina follows the story of a bumblebee that is made to believe she is not as competent as the honeybees. But through an expected encounter with a flower, she discovers that what makes her different is exactly what makes her extraordinary. This story celebrates resilience and uniqueness and is also an opportunity to educate children of the bumblebee's unique ability to buzz polinate.
Hansel and Gretel
A rendition of the classic Hansel and Gretel portrayed as intimate story of sibling connection rather than a tale of menace. The visual narrative focuses on the combined experience and with it emotional bond between the two children.
Squawk
Squawk is a children's picturebook that explores the notion of collective belonging and place. It is a story told from the perspective of suspecting pigeons, who with the arrival of the unexpected parakeets learn to deal with change.
